How to Secure Your Private Keys: Best Practices

- Understanding the importance of private keys in cryptocurrency
- Choosing a secure storage solution for your private keys
- Creating strong passwords for your private keys
- Back up and recovery strategies for private keys
- Avoiding common pitfalls and mistakes with private keys
- Implementing multi-factor authentication for added security
Understanding the importance of private keys in cryptocurrency
Cryptocurrency private keys are crucial components of securing your digital assets. Private keys are essentially long strings of alphanumeric characters that allow you to access and manage your cryptocurrency holdings. They serve as a form of digital signature, proving ownership of your funds and enabling you to authorize transactions on the blockchain.
It is important to understand the significance of private keys in cryptocurrency because they are the primary means by which you can control and protect your funds. If someone gains access to your private keys, they essentially have full control over your cryptocurrency holdings and can transfer them to their own wallets without your consent.
Therefore, it is imperative to keep your private keys secure and confidential at all times. This means storing them in a safe place, such as a hardware wallet or encrypted USB drive, and refraining from sharing them with anyone else. Additionally, it is recommended to regularly back up your private keys to prevent the risk of losing access to your funds in case of a hardware failure or other unforeseen circumstances.
Choosing a secure storage solution for your private keys
When it comes to safeguarding your private keys, choosing a secure storage solution is crucial. There are several options available, each with its own set of advantages and disadvantages. It’s important to weigh these factors carefully to ensure the safety of your keys.
One popular choice for storing private keys is a hardware wallet. These devices are specifically designed to securely store keys offline, making them less vulnerable to hacking or malware attacks. While hardware wallets can be a bit more expensive than other options, many people find the peace of mind they offer to be well worth the investment.
Another option is a paper wallet, which involves printing out your keys and storing them in a physical location. This method is cost-effective and easy to implement, but it also comes with its own set of risks. Paper can be easily lost, damaged, or stolen, so it’s important to keep your paper wallet in a safe and secure location.
For those who prefer a more digital solution, there are also software wallets available. These wallets store your keys on your computer or mobile device, making them easily accessible for everyday use. However, storing keys on a connected device also comes with risks, as these devices can be vulnerable to cyber attacks.
Ultimately, the best storage solution for your private keys will depend on your individual needs and preferences. It’s important to carefully consider the pros and cons of each option before making a decision. Whichever method you choose, remember to always keep backups of your keys in a secure location and regularly update your security measures to protect against potential threats.
Creating strong passwords for your private keys
Creating strong passwords for your private keys is crucial to ensuring the security of your digital assets. When it comes to generating a password, you should avoid using easily guessable combinations, such as “123456” or “password”. Instead, opt for a mix of uppercase and lowercase letters, numbers, and special characters.
It is also essential to refrain from using personal information, such as your name, birthdate, or address, in your password. Hackers can easily obtain this information through social engineering tactics or data breaches. Consider using a passphrase instead of a single word, as it can be more secure and easier to remember.
Remember to never reuse passwords across different accounts. If one account is compromised, all accounts using the same password could be at risk. Additionally, regularly updating your passwords can help mitigate the risk of unauthorized access to your private keys.
Back up and recovery strategies for private keys
When it comes to securing your private keys, having a solid back up and recovery strategy is crucial. In the event that your private keys are lost or compromised, having a backup plan in place can help prevent permanent loss of access to your digital assets. Here are some best practices to consider:
- Regularly back up your private keys to an external storage device such as a USB drive or external hard drive. Make sure to encrypt the backup to add an extra layer of security.
- Store your backup in a secure location away from your primary device to protect against physical damage or theft.
- Consider using a secure cloud storage service to store an encrypted copy of your private keys. This can provide an additional layer of redundancy in case your physical backups are lost or damaged.
- Set up a secure recovery process in case you need to access your private keys from a backup. This could involve using multi-factor authentication or requiring approval from multiple trusted parties.
- Regularly test your backup and recovery process to ensure that you can successfully recover your private keys in a real-world scenario.
By implementing a robust back up and recovery strategy for your private keys, you can help protect your digital assets and ensure that you maintain access to them in the event of unforeseen circumstances. Remember, it’s always better to be safe than sorry when it comes to securing your private keys.
Avoiding common pitfalls and mistakes with private keys
When it comes to securing your private keys, there are several common pitfalls and mistakes that you should be aware of in order to protect your cryptocurrency assets. Here are some best practices to help you avoid these pitfalls and keep your private keys secure:
- Do not share your private keys with anyone. Keep them confidential and secure at all times.
- Avoid storing your private keys on online platforms or exchanges. Use a hardware wallet or offline storage solution instead.
- Be cautious of phishing attempts that try to trick you into revealing your private keys. Always verify the authenticity of websites and emails before providing any sensitive information.
- Regularly backup your private keys and store them in a secure location. Having a backup will help you recover your assets in case of loss or theft.
- Update your security software regularly to protect your devices from malware and cyber attacks that could compromise your private keys.
Implementing multi-factor authentication for added security
Implementing multi-factor authentication (MFA) is an essential step in enhancing the security of your private keys. By requiring users to provide two or more forms of verification before granting access, MFA significantly reduces the risk of unauthorized access to sensitive information. This added layer of security makes it much harder for attackers to compromise your private keys, even if they manage to obtain your password through phishing or other means.
There are several different factors that can be used for multi-factor authentication, including something you know (such as a password), something you have (such as a smartphone or security token), and something you are (such as a fingerprint or facial recognition). By combining these different factors, MFA provides a more robust defense against unauthorized access than password-based authentication alone.
When implementing multi-factor authentication for your private keys, it is important to choose factors that are both secure and convenient for your users. For example, you may want to require users to enter a one-time code sent to their smartphone in addition to their password, or use a biometric scan as an additional form of verification. By striking the right balance between security and usability, you can ensure that your private keys are well protected without sacrificing user experience.